Hello MAriusz! Your item made in Krakow bitween 1872-1919. The lion head was the hallmark for small items, fineness 750 in the Austro-Hungarian Empire. Letter E shows the assay office in Krakow. http://www.925-1000.com/Faustria_02.html Your hallmarks is upside down. Unfortunatly I don't know the mak...

Hello! The "U with the crown" is the hallmark in Romania bitween 1937-1949 for 750‰. The U was some of the Romanian assay region. The R was an "occupation mark" as you can read here: viewtopic.php?f=38&t=34902 Best Regards! Krisztián
